eastern iowa is seeing a growth
in urgent care centers. that's
part of a national
trend according to the american
academy of
urgent care medicine.
a new urgent care center opened
in cedar falls
yesterday. and another will
start
serving patients next week in
dubuque. they are part of the 50 to 100
urgent care clinics
that open each year in the u-s.
and more than 9,000 centers
have opened in the u-s since
2008.
the center say the goal is to
give more people an
alternative to going to the
emergency room.
